Privacy Encoder® is a cloud platform designed to manage Data Protection within a company in an integrated and centralized manner, with a particular focus on GDPR.
It enables you to manage notices, records, appointments, risks, incidents, data subject rights, and documentation, transforming compliance from an abstract obligation into a clear and traceable operational process.

Yes. Privacy Encoder® is multilingual: it is available in Italian, German, French, English (and other languages supported by the group), enabling it to accommodate the typical setup of multilingual Swiss groups and international organizations.
Data is stored in cloud environments that are secure and compliant with international security standards, with data centers located in jurisdictions appropriate to the nature of the service (Italian & European context).
Details on location and security measures can be provided in the contractual documentation and in the Data Processing Agreement (DPA).

Yes. When using Privacy Encoder® as a tool supporting the Data Controller, a Data Processing Agreement / appointment as Data Processor is provided, in compliance with the GDPR.
For groups or complex structures, we assess together the correct configuration of roles (controller, joint controllers, processors, sub-processors).
